Transaction 3e0f9927114091a15a8ae61ac482b983ad70f10f265b4c6092504729cee60e49

57 Input
2 Outputs
  • 3e0f9927114091a15a8ae61ac482b983ad70f10f265b4c6092504729cee60e49:0
  • value  546
    address  12EW4i4Kuz682VnNDpcJAqYZy2kkGZKAQZ
  • 3e0f9927114091a15a8ae61ac482b983ad70f10f265b4c6092504729cee60e49:1
  • value  39365248
    address  35U5QPCF2hwhZtqewEwCGghdMM4rndUbbQ